site stats

Recursion application in data structure

WebAbout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ators ... WebJun 16, 2005 · A linked list consists of a node structure that contains two members: the data it is holding and a pointer to another node structure (or NULL, to terminate the list). …

Microsoft Apps

WebNested Recursion in C. In Nested recursion, the recursive function will pass the parameter as a recursive call. For better understanding, please have a look at the below image. In the below image nested is a recursive function which calls itself. But the parameter itself is a recursive call i.e. nested(v-1). This is called nested recursion. WebThrough this application we are granted access to numerous widely used algorithms implementing Data Structures & learn its plethora applications. The programs included under the Recursion section helps us to comprehend the mechanism of recursion. These programs guides us to formulate facile recursive solutions of otherwise enigmatic … h2o2 treatment arabidopsis https://artisanflare.com

Nested Recursion in C with Examples - Dot Net Tutorials

WebAug 9, 2024 · Photo by JJ Ying on Unsplash. The reason a linked list is considered a recursive data structure is because the next variable contains a type of Node itself. In Java the code would look something like this: public class Node < T > {public T value; public Node < T > next;}As you can see, the next Variable inside Node is itself of type Node.Therefore a … WebMar 28, 2024 · Five Main Recursion Methods in Data Structure Methods There are five main recursion methods programmers can use in functional programming. And, they are: Tail … WebNov 8, 2024 · The practical applications of recursion are near endless. Many math functions cannot be expressed without its use. The more famous ones are the Fibonacci sequence … h2o3 dry bath

What are the advantages and disadvantages of recursion?

Category:Recursion in Data Structure, Def, Types, Importance DataTrained

Tags:Recursion application in data structure

Recursion application in data structure

Recursion (computer science) - Wikipedia

WebA recursion tree is a tree diagram of recursive calls where each tree node represents the cost of a certain subproblem. The idea is simple! The time complexity of recursion depends on two factors: 1) The total number of recursive calls and 2) The time complexity of additional operations for each recursive call. WebYou also use attributes to define the structure of your jobs and positions. You can specify attributes at the enterprise level for jobs and positions, at the business unit level for positions, and at the reference data set level for jobs. Job and position structures are optional. Enterprise-Level Job Attributes

Recursion application in data structure

Did you know?

WebFeb 4, 2024 · Application of Recursion Recursion:- Recursion is a method of solving problems that involves breaking a problem down into smaller and smaller subproblems … WebChoosing the right data structure is pivotal to optimizing the performance and scalability of applications. This new edition of Hands-On Data Structures and Algorithms with Python will expand your understanding of key structures, including stacks, queues, and lists, and also show you how to apply priority queues and heaps in applications.

WebFeb 16, 2024 · Recursion. Used in IDEs to check for proper parentheses matching Media playlist. T o play previous and next song Application of Queue: A queue is a data structure … WebRecursion is the process in which a function calls itself up to n-number of times. If a program allows the user to call a function inside the same function recursively, the procedure is called a recursive call of the function. Furthermore, a recursive function can call itself directly or indirectly in the same program. Syntax of the Recursion ...

WebSep 19, 2008 · There is no recursion in the real-world. Recursion is a mathematical abstraction. You can model lots of things using recursion. In that sense, Fibonacci is … WebFeb 20, 2024 · To build a recursive algorithm, you will break the given problem statement into two parts. The first one is the base case, and the second one is the recursive step. …

WebA data structure is a way of storing data in a computer so that it can be used efficiently and it will allow the most efficient algorithm to be used. The choice of the data structure begins from the choice of an ... Recursion uses selection structure whereas iteration uses repetetion structure. 9 Types of Recursion:

WebFirst, create the Java application (in our example the name of the application is Recursion): package recursion; import java.util.*; public class Recursion { public static void main... brackley holdings ltdWebToggle Recursive data types subsection 2.1Inductively defined data 2.2Coinductively defined data and corecursion 3Types of recursion Toggle Types of recursion subsection … h2o2 structure in solid phaseWebRecursion is the phenomenon in programming where a function, called the recursive function calls itself directly or indirectly based on certain conditions. Example: void recursion (int n) { if (n==0) return; else recursion (n-1); } What is recursion in language? h2o2 ultraviolet absorption spectrumWebOct 2, 2024 · About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Press Copyright Contact us Creators ... h2o2 reductionWebDec 22, 2016 · The frequency response function is a quantitative measure used in structural analysis and engineering design; hence, it is targeted for accuracy. For a large structure, a high number of substructures, also called cells, must be considered, which will lead to a high amount of computational time. In this paper, the recursive method, a finite element … h2o2 water reactionWebRecursion is a widely used idea in data structures and algorithms to solve complex problems by breaking them down into simpler ones. In this blog, we will understand the basic concepts of recursion and help you refine one of the critical problem-solving skills in data structures and algorithms. What do you mean by recursion? brackley homesWebYes, I would say recursion is very useful when dealing with data structures like trees. In fact any time a data structure can be viewed as being composed in some way of several parts, … h2o2 water